My approach to therapy

My theoretical foundation is grounded in compassion, self-acceptance, and personal growth. I believe that every individual possesses an inherent capacity for change and self-actualization when provided with the right environment and support. My approach is deeply influenced by the humanistic perspective, which emphasizes personal agency, intrinsic motivation, and the belief that people are naturally inclined toward growth when given the opportunity to explore their thoughts and emotions in a safe, accepting space.
